I had to replace my flares again. The three year expiration date is up.
I decided to to some price comparison checking Cabela , West Marine , Bass pro, and Walmart.
At walmart the set of handheld Orion flares is $24,98 , the other stores charge between $34 and $38.
The flares you can shoot from a flare pistol are $19.93 at Walmart and at least $10 dollars more in the other stores.
So the 2 packages totalled $45 at Wallmart. In one of the above mentioned stores these 2 products sold for $80.
I do not like shopping in Walmart, but I hate getting ripped of at stores that have the word sport or boat in their name.

Starting battery should be stand alone for one obvious reason. Trolling motors may also get you back to port if the main engine fails. That leaves you with the least essential battery to wire them up to ,fish hawk and fishfinder battery and no, that will not cause any interference.

Pap. I did a seminar with on of the okuma guys a couple years ago. They use the walleye copper from Blood Run. They use shrink tubing to achieve different depths. From anything from 20 to around 60'. They use the shrink tubing to hook there board on.
